February 13, 2004 |

Redrawing the Boundaries

Calling Georgia's House and Senate maps "baldly unconstitutional" and based on reasoning that "went far beyond anything the Supreme Court has ever allowed," a federal panel has ruled that the legislative maps violate equal rights principles and unjustifiably protect Democrat-leaning areas. Democrats testified they had drawn the districts to protect incumbents and say the ruling may have set a different standard than is used by 24 other states.

December 06, 1999 |

Joint And Several Justices

When celebrating Supreme Court justices who shaped our constitutional tradition, we tend to concentrate on individual achievements. On rare occasions, though, an intellectual bond between two justices is so intense, the shared impact so significant, their contributions may be appreciated in combination. The careers of Chief Justice Earl Warren and Justice William Brennan, Jr., are one of the best cases in point. Their collaboration was the harbinger of a partnership that altered American constitutional law.
